Sounds like you're having anxiety attacks over your shame from this.

Perhaps talk to your doctor and see if you can get some chemical and counseling help to be able to work through the panic/overwhelm while you're having them. It will help you with your processing.

The following are thoughts from my perspective as a WW (who's made a lot of mistakes in my own progress of hoping for R). Primarily, I'm giving you this insight as a woman who's had problems in her marriage (although minor) with porn use and major problems with being compared negatively to other women (physically and otherwise).

Please take them to heart- your wife may be "forgiving" you and not bringing these things up now, but she will likely do in the future as she calms down and is able to process the shock. She may be in "freeze" mode and not know what to do or even how to feel about it. She's could dissociate from the circumstance (where you just blank it out or go on "autopilot" to avoid feeling). Either way, be prepared for her to return to the subject. With a lot of STRONG emotions.

When she does, don't do as I did and give her the truth in bits and pieces. Don't minimize the encounters- those are likely going to be as hurtful as the extended porn use. Porn for women really wreaks havoc on our sense of self worth- ask me how I know (and my BH only used it sparingly in our early marriage and stopped soon after). As this sinks in, she will likely have difficulty with body image and being intimate to you- she can't live up to the fantasies you saw online.

About your 2 encounters with men. You had one night stand AP's. Your language on the encounters that "happened" is passive and not accountable for your contributions to them. To make them happen, you had to contact the AP, arrange time to meet the AP, find a private location to spend time with the AP and then consciously physically interact with the AP. In the future (again, do better than I did), take full accountability when speaking of these instances- they didn't just "happen." It will help you to understand what you were really capable of doing to your BW and help her understand you're taking responsibility for your actions. This will make you a safer spouse in her eyes.

SMA hang in there!

It's the worst at first when you see the pain you've caused and feel the shame of your own behaviors that caused it.

Get IC. NOW. YESTERDAY. Look for someone competent in dealing with sexual issues and overcoming shame.

Shame spirals suck. That's what you're likely in right now. If you google the term, you can find some helpful articles on that.

When it's this bleak, do something good for yourself- take a shower, go for a walk, call a friend/ family member. Do something nice for someone else (pay ahead on a Starbucks order or something).

You are deserving of respect and care. You are willing to work to be a person who can respect and care for themselves.

Hang on to that, it will help you through.
